Wendy Moniz

Wendy Moniz made her debut on Guiding Light on February 17, 1995 as Dinah Marler. The character left the show in February 1999. Moniz has been a fan of Guiding Light since she was in sixth grade.

Wendy received a Bachelor of Arts degree in English and acting from Siena College. Her theater credits include Crimes of the Heart, Baby with the Bathwater, Killgarden, The Sound of Music, Grease, Jospeh and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at, and Agnes of God. She has also appeared in print ads and commercials.

Wendy was born on January 19 in Kansas City, MO. She was raised in Fall River, MA. She enjoys cooking, singing, and reading. She lived to collect movie posters. Wendy has been divorced from her first husband, David, since 1996.

    Honors:

  • Named one of Soap Opera's 50 Most Beautiful People by Soap Opera Weekly (3/3/98 issue)
  • Named one of Daytime's 50 Most Beautiful People by Soap Opera Magazine (7/14/98 issue)
  • Soap Opera Weekly's Outstanding Performer for the week of June 22nd, 7/21/98 issue
  • Soap Opera Digest's performer of the week, 8/4/98 issue
  • Soap Opera Magazine's Star of the Week (10/27/98 issue)
